Strategic Giving : Reduce Your Taxes While Supporting a Cause

Are you looking for ways to enhance your charitable impact while also reducing your tax burden? Look no further than smart giving! Smart giving requires carefully planning your donations to utilize the power of tax deductions. By familiarizing yourself with the various tax breaks available for charitable giving, you can make a substantial difference in your community while also reducing your financial obligations.

One effective strategy is to give appreciated property like stocks or real estate. This can reduce capital gains taxes while still providing a valuable gift to your chosen charity.

  • Moreover, consider making periodic donations throughout the year to maximize your tax benefits.
  • Ultimately, it's crucial to consult a qualified tax advisor to formulate a smart giving plan that addresses your unique financial needs and goals.
